What to do if you have anger problems?
Feeling anger is totally normal after experiencing frustrating, painful or unfair moments. In fact, it can be considered a healthy emotion, as long as it does not become uncontrolled or destructive. Middle class: money, happiness or both
Money does not bring happiness, it brings comfort. Happiness does not require money: it needs a sense of purpose and simple pleasures. Money and happiness compete over similar resources.
